What is forex trading? -Forex, also known as FX, is short for the Foreign Exchange Market -the biggest financial market there is; it handles $3 trillion worth of daily transactions. The New York Stock Exchange would need 3 trading days to come close to what forex handles daily. Forex is where foreign currencies are exchanged with one another. Big banks and financial institutions are responsible for 95% of the transactions handled daily in the forex market.

5% of the transactions are done by individuals, private traders armed with nothing but a clear understanding of how the forex market works, the will to make it big, and the best forex trade tracking software and forex systems in their own home laptop computers.

Why is there a Foreign Exchange Market?

For one, the value of a currency internationally can be determined with how it values against another currency. For instance, an exchange between the US Dollar and the Philippine Peso occurs. It will be represented as such: USD/PHP. Say the 1 USD is worth 40.50 PHP, that tells you how much the PHP values against the USD, and vice versa.In the modern world ran by finance, there is a need for standardization, a way to keep the world’s different currencies in check. The forex market is a way to apply this standardization, while still allowing for open and liberal trade on all fronts.

Day trading not only occurs in the stock market, but also in the forex market. This requires the utmost forex trade tracking available only on select trading software systems. Day trading is when a trader opens up and closes for business on the same trading day. With this method of trading, it’s not absolutely necessary to follow long term market trends because you base decision on catching immediate price swings.
